Tuesday Film Panel Plenary Session with JVIR awards recognition
Tuesday, June 14, 10:30 a.m. – noon
Location: Boston Convention and Exhibition Center, room Ballroom
Come celebrate the accomplishments and culture of IR in today’s plenary, held at 10:30 a.m. in the Ballroom.
Journal of Vascular and Interventional Radiology (JVIR) Editor-in-chief Daniel Y. Sze, MD, PhD, FSIR, will begin the session by presenting awards to authors and reviewers who made the most indelible impact on the journal’s content and, hence, on the IR literature base in 2021. In addition to the JVIR Editor’s Awards for Outstanding Clinical Study and Outstanding Laboratory Investigation (a total of 13 awards, an increase of two total in prior years), Dr. Sze is introducing new award categories this year: Peers’ Choice (awarding highly cited papers) and People’s Choice (awarding papers with the highest number of downloads). During the session, he will also recognize the Top Reviewers of 2021 and describe the new 13-SA-CME-credit opportunity based on the 2021 Top Paper Award winners (free for SIR members to purchase during the week of SIR 2022, with 3 years in which the activity must be completed for credit). After the award presentations, stay tuned for the always-popular Film Panel presentation, which will make its grand return this year. Moderated by Minhaj S. Khaja, MD, MBA, FSIR, and Charles A. Gilliland, MD, this exciting and creative session is an IR game show like no other. From quizzes to skits to original films in past years, the Film Panel session never fails to excite and to leave a lasting impression.
Today’s theme may be a closely guarded secret, but moderators are certain that the costumes and acting will leave members hungry for more.
